At its core, DDD Medical prioritizes accurate diagnosis as the foundational step toward effective treatment. This involves leveraging cutting-edge technologies such as advanced imaging, genomic testing, and biomarker analysis. For instance, in cases of cancer, molecular profiling enables doctors to identify specific mutations within tumor cells, facilitating targeted therapies rather than traditional, one-size-fits-all treatments. Such precision not only increases the likelihood of success but also minimizes unnecessary side effects, making treatment more tolerable for patients.
Beyond diagnostics, DDD Medical underscores the importance of individualized treatment plans. This approach considers a patient’s unique genetic makeup, lifestyle, and comorbidities to craft a personalized therapy regimen. For chronic conditions like diabetes or cardiovascular disease, this means moving away from generic medication protocols towards customized interventions that optimize efficacy. For example, pharmacogenomics allows clinicians to select medications and dosages best suited to a patient’s genetic profile, reducing adverse reactions and improving disease management.
